Questions about this program

How big is the program signal?

Electrical/Electronic Engineering Technologies/Technicians accounts for 0.5% of reported programs at Purdue University-Main Campus, which is bigger than 39% of schools in this field set and below the national average concentration. The enrollment proxy is about 218 students when that share is applied to current enrollment.

How should I read the cost number?

Purdue University-Main Campus's average net price is $14,600 per year, about $58,400 over four years. That is $3,363 above the $11,237 peer average, before your own aid package changes the final bill.

Are the earnings major-specific?

No. The $72,424 median earnings figure is school-wide ten years after entry. It is $27,950 above the $44,474 average among schools reporting this field, so treat it as an outcomes proxy rather than a department guarantee.
